I Have A 98 Blazer 4 Door. I Don't Get Any Heat.my Blower Is Working And My Tempt. Does Not Go Over 110-115.any Sugg. Would Be Appreciated. Thanks.

if your engine temp is not getting over 115 then you may have a thermostat thats stuck open and that could be why you don't have any heat. is your fuel economy low or does the truck feel sluggish at all?

Exactly what ZL1 said.... I would have the thermostat changed and flush the cooling system and replace with dexcool only. Good luck and let us know the outcome
